Dive into the gripping realms of mental health and extraordinary storytelling with "Moon Knight by Lemire & Smallwood: The Complete Collection". This definitive collection encapsulates the daring and emotional journey of Mark Spector, aka Moon Knight, through his struggles with Dissociative Identity Disorder. Written by Jeff Lemire and illustrated by Greg Smallwood, this edition brings forth a rich, dynamic narrative paired with striking artwork that not only entertains but resonates deeply.
In this edition, readers are treated to a transformative experience that extends beyond typical comic book storylines. The artwork is a masterpiece, crafted with delicate care, capturing the various states of mind of its conflicted protagonist with every turn of the page. The collaboration between the writer and the artists infuses the story with an art style that shifts to reflect Moon Knight’s complex psyche, making it a visual treat worth savoring.

When compared to other graphic novels like "Vision", this collection stands out not only for its emotional depth but also for the way it tackles complex issues in a superhero context. While both works are lauded for their engaging narratives, "Moon Knight" offers a unique perspective by blending heroic adventures with raw psychological exploration, making it a must-read for anyone looking to delve deeper into the human experience.
